George W. Christopher
About
George W. Christopher has authored 21 papers that have received a total of 869 indexed citations.
This includes 11 papers in Infectious Diseases, 9 papers in Molecular Biology and 4 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Viral Infections and Outbreaks Research (10 papers), Biological Agents for Bioterrorism (9 papers) and Viral Infections and Vectors (4 papers). George W. Christopher is often cited by papers focused on Viral Infections and Outbreaks Research (10 papers), Biological Agents for Bioterrorism (9 papers) and Viral Infections and Vectors (4 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States and Germany. George W. Christopher's co-authors include Edward M. Eitzen, Theodore J. Cieslak, Julie A. Pavlin, Mark G. Kortepeter and Ronald B. Reisler and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Clinical Infectious Diseases and Spine.
